The Internal Displacement Solutions Fund (IDSF) is a United Nations financing mechanism established to catalyse nationally led, development-oriented solutions to internal displacement. The Fund supports governments, Resident Coordinators and UN Country Teams to move beyond short-term responses and advance durable solutions that improve access to housing, livelihoods, services, documentation and social protection for internally displaced persons and displacement-affected communities.
IDSF provides targeted catalytic financing to help countries strengthen national leadership, develop and implement solutions strategies, improve data and evidence, and connect initial investments to larger-scale public, bilateral and multilateral financing. The Fund also supports learning across its country portfolio and generates evidence on approaches that can be replicated or scaled.

Important information for US Permanent Residents (‘Green Card’ holders)
Under US immigration law, acceptance of a staff position with UNDP, an international organization, may have significant implications for US Permanent Residents. UNDP advises applicants for all professional level posts that they must relinquish their US Permanent Resident status and accept a G-4 visa, or have submitted a valid application for US citizenship prior to commencement of employment.
UNDP is not in a position to provide advice or assistance on applying for US citizenship and therefore applicants are advised to seek the advice of competent immigration lawyers regarding any applications.
